LWV Elder Care Consensus Meeting
About this event
This is the heart of LWV work. Each of us with either be a caregiver or need a caregiver at some point in our lives. This study focuses on caregiving in Washington state and specifically caregiving for vulnerable adults 60 years of age or older who reside in their own homes and communities. The League of Women Voters of Washington authorized the study at its May 2023 convention. This is your opportunity to participate in the process for reaching consensus on the issues identified in the study. The state board will use the feedback provided by local Leagues to develop state positions. How can you participate? First, we ask that you read the study. (see Links below) Second, participate in meeting designed to provide information, facilitate discussion, and answer the consensus questions. Scroll down to the questions at the end of the form. LWV Snohomish County will be holding this one meeting. Registration will help us plan this event. Consensus is an active process with live back and forth. If you can not attend, but have information the group should be aware of regarding the consensus questions, please, contact us. We hope that each of you will participate in this important process.
